Machu Picchu and Sacred Valley Overnight Tour

This private tour will be a long guided excursion journey through the magnificent Sacred Valley of the Incas and at last the visit to the Inca citadel of Machu Picchu the new 7th wonder of the world. You will travel by train to Aguas Calientes, spend the night and have a private guided tour of Machu Picchu the following morning.

Itinerary

Day 1: Cusco - Sacred Valley

Stop At: Sacred Valley of the Incas, 0051 Peru
The sacred Valley of the Incas it’s Located between the Village of Pisaq and Ollantaytambo, it has wonderful Andean Landscapes, where its inhabitants are native of the ethnic Quechua, conserves many customs and ancestral rites as well as its traditional clothing. Here you will appreciate and magnify the high technological development that the Incas Achieved on agriculture through system of Andenerias (set of land terraces in staggered form on the mountains to be used in the sowing).The tour Begins in Cusco, where we will pick you up from your Hotel at 8:00 am. and begin our journey our first stop will be at the Llama farm Awana Cancha, where we will find not only the variety of Andean Camelids Like llamas, alpacas, Guanaco and Vicuña but also a group of native people from Different communities of Peru dressed in their traditional clothes, and all of them Practicing the art of weaving textiles. Then the trip continues through the ruins of Pisac with panoramic views of the jagged granite peaks before stopping in the town to visit one of the best textile markets in the Andes. There, you’ll be able to look for souvenirs and learn about the local culture, lunch here on your own and then we have a beautiful ride along the Sacred Valley. The next stop is Ollantaytambo at 9,200ft, this is a small town with impressive Inca ruins, where we will visit the archaeological site. After visiting the ruins, we will go to the train station where we will then board the famous Vistadome or Expedition train to the quaint little town of Aguas Calientes, the gateway to Machu Picchu. You will spend the night here and be able to enjoy the town and have a nice dinner in your own.

Day 2: Machu Picchu

Stop At: Machu Picchu, Machu Picchu, Sacred Valley, Cusco Region
This morning, your guide will pick you up from the lobby of your hotel early in the morning, you will take the 30 minute shuttle bus ride up to the mountain citadel of Machu Picchu. Everywhere you look, you will be more and more impressed by the magnificent city built by the Incas, so many, many years ago. You will then enjoy a 3 hour tour with your knowledgeable, English speaking, private guide and afterwards have some time to explore on your own. Then you will take the shuttle bus back to Aguas Calientes, have some lunch on your own before boarding the train back to Ollantaytambo where your driver will be waiting for you to return you to Cusco.
